The 2UZ uses a hot-wire MAF. Pin (Signal) and E2G (MAF Ground). If you use cheap wire splices, the voltage drop on the ground wire will shift the MAF reading by 10-15%. The engine will run lean at cruise and rich at WOT. Fix: Solder and heat shrink. Never use a T-tap on a MAF ground.

Toyota produced the 2UZ-FE from 1998 to 2011 across multiple platforms (Lexus LX470, Toyota Land Cruiser J100/J105, Tundra, Sequoia, and 4Runner).
